ZIP Code 03243: frequently asked questions

What is the median home value in ZIP Code 03243?
The median home value in ZIP Code 03243 is $304,400, higher than 70%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much is property tax in ZIP Code 03243?
The median annual property tax in ZIP Code 03243 is $4,902, an effective rate of 2% of home value.
Is ZIP Code 03243 expensive to live in?
Homes in ZIP Code 03243 cost about 3.65× the median household income, higher than 68%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much have home prices grown in ZIP Code 03243?
Home prices in ZIP Code 03243 have moved 82% over the past five years (5.1% in the past year), per the FHFA House Price Index.
What is the weather like in ZIP Code 03243?
ZIP Code 03243 averages 45.2°F year-round, summer highs near 79.2°F, winter lows around 12°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 61.9 inches of snow a year.
Is ZIP Code 03243 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
ZIP Code 03243's FEMA National Risk Index score is 70.8 (higher than 57% of U.S. ZIP codes).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is hurricane.
